Laboratory flu clinic begins Oct. 27
Occupational Medicine (HSR-2) will again be offering free flu vaccinations for Laboratory workers beginning Oct. 27 and continuing through Nov. 7 or until all the vaccine is administered.

Laboratory procurement expo Wednesday, Thursday in Española
The Laboratory is hosting a procurement expo on Wednesday and Thursday in Espaņola to bring together the small-business community, key federal, state and local government procurement agencies and their major subcontractors to explore and promote available procurement opportunities at the Lab.
